Upham, New Brunswick (1921 census)
Upham was a census subdivision in New Brunswick, recorded in the 1921 Census of Canada with a population of 820. The community is grounded to Wikidata Q7898296. The administrative centroid was at approximately 45.508°N, 65.662°W.
Population
In 1921, Upham had a population of 820: 428 male and 392 female residents.
Population trajectory across census years
| Year | Population |
|---|---|
| 1871 | 1,413 |
| 1881 | 1,421 |
| 1891 | 1,145 |
| 1901 | 981 |
| 1911 | 845 |
| 1921 | 820 |

Full census record, 1921
The 1921 census recorded 24 measurements for this Census Subdivision across 3 categories.
Population & families (1921). This community's record includes 820 total population, 428 males in the population, 410 males born in Canada, 392 females in the population, 385 females born in Canada, 13 males born in the British Empire (excluding Canada), 5 females born in the British Empire (excluding Canada), 5 males born outside the British Empire, 2 females born outside the British Empire. (Source: 1921 Census of Canada, V1T16.)
Ethnic origin (1921). This community's record includes 364 persons of British origin (Irish), 235 persons of British origin (Scotch / Scottish), 202 persons of British origin (English), 6 persons of French origin, 6 persons of Scandinavian origin, 5 persons of Dutch origin, 1 persons of British origin (other), 1 persons of German origin. (Source: 1921 Census of Canada, V1T27.)
Religion (1921). This community's record includes 358 Anglicans (Church of England), 206 Presbyterians, 112 Roman Catholics, 106 Baptists, 34 Methodists, 3 Lutherans, 1 adherents of other sects (residual category in 1921). (Source: 1921 Census of Canada, V1T38.)
